ur collaboration with Red Elephant Beer Cellar is based on a classic Belgian Tripel , with a wild twist using the ingredients from three native trees, Blackthorn, Cheery and Rowan, which all impart a subtle almond flavour to the beer.
With unmistakable Belgian yeast character, high levels of carbonisation and balanced levels of booziness this is one to savour and share with friends. Best served in a stemmed glass, slightly chilled.
